What do I need to bail someone out of jail?You will need the premium (the premium is generally 10% of the total bail amount), a qualified Indemnitor (the Indemnitor is financially responsible for the bail bond) and possibly some form of collateral for larger bonds. How long will it take to release them from jail?For most transactions, the paperwork usually takes about 20 minutes. Release time from local jails is usually under an hour. The release time from county jails varies, but is typically 2-4 hours. In some situations it can take longer. As a Cosigner or Indemnitor, what are my responsibilities?You are responsible for ensuring that the defendant shows up for their scheduled court dates and that is it. You are not signing to guarantee the defendant's guilt or innocence. How much does a bail bond cost?In most cases in Columbia, Missouri and Boone County, the cost of the bail bond, which is called the premium, is 10% of the bail bond amount. What if I don’t have the full 10%?Often times, we can arrange for you to make payments on the premium. How do they set the bail amount?Boone County Judges are responsible for setting bail. Because many people want to get out of jail immediately and, depending on when you are arrested, it can take up to five days to see a judge in Colubmia, Missouri, most jails have standard bail schedules which specify bail amounts for common crimes. You can get out of jail quickly by paying the amount set forth in the bail schedule. Why won't other bail bondsmen serve students?Students are generally considered a high flight risk.
